Truffles not only grow in Italy and France. The soil in the "Nord vaudois", the main Swiss truffle area, is also suitable for this treasure of such delicate aroma. Heading out to discover this precious mushroom accompanied by keen and interesting guides is an experience offered to interested individuals and amateur truffle hunters.
In the area of Bonvillars, two accompanying guides in conjunction with the Truffle Association of Western Switzerland, offer unforgettable foraging walks to discover Swiss truffles.
The programme includes explanatory animation and truffle dog demonstrations along the path. The stroll ends in a relaxed atmosphere taking refreshments based on a truffle tasting accompanied by regional wines.
